    If you need a restaurant that delivers quality, made to order fish and chips at a solid price, look no further than Hook, Line & Sinker! Stopped by during lunch to try their 2 PC fish & chips. Subbed the coleslaw out for potato salad, which is made in house and has a refreshing taste. The fish batter was light but crispy, and the fish itself was buttery smooth! The fries did their job and were very hot! All in all a delicious meal. Nice service too by the man at the register, who gave me a full list of options to sub out the coleslaw which allowed me to enjoy their potato salad. Plenty of indoor seating as well with some nice cartoon style paintings on the walls along with themed sea decor. I am indeed "hooked" after my first bite at Hook, Line & Sinker! I will be back to explore more of their deep sea menu.

    I was so pleasantly surprised by HLS! Came in here ready to just get fish and chips but we were stopped short by the massive menu. We ended up ordering the house fish and chips, the red snapper fish and chips, mahi mahi grilled sandwich, and a couple of appetizers. The house fish and chips are made from basa fish and the texture is very mushy and soft, and the flavor was not for me - I would not order this again. The snapper fish and chips were delicious! The batter was perfectly fried and crispy without being hard. And the grilled mahi mahi sandwich was so balanced and perfectly cooked! This was easily my favorite. The two appetizers were ok. The other thing that stood out to me was their cocktail sauce, it actually had horseradish in it and was very good!! Service was friendly and quick. It's a no frills restaurant that looks like they've been there a while. Ample parking in a huge lot. Definitely recommend this place!
